CHP Sergeant Linda Powell has set up a way for you to share that outgoing love on Thanksgiving. And it’s hecka fun. AND you can help our Senior Center feed seniors. IT”S A TURKEY TROT! For 6 years our LoCaLs, around 300 of them, have gathered and enjoyed the super brisk morning to run, jog or walk (even if you gotta use a walker) along this lovely 5k course. Bring your family, friends, unsuspecting guests...Prizes are given for the first finisher, largest family and the best costume, the largest family so far was 27! Admission is a nonperishable food item for the Lassen County Senior Services, but just so you know LCSS will also accept cash :) What better way to celebrate Thanksgiving.

                                   

                       
Now, a few shout outs. Just more LoCaLs to be grateful for~
Linda Powell, she shares her love for running with events and coaching pre-k to 8th grade in addition to her job as a full time CHP Sergeant!
Penny and everyone at the Senior Center, the food and donations collected from this event will be used not only for meals at the center but also bags will be made up and delivered to shut ins.
